z是一个shell脚本,可以帮你快速的切换目录。至于是什么原理我还没有深究,有兴趣的东西可以看下。
z的源码在这里:https://github.com/rupa/z
你把源码复制到你的用户目录下的z.sh文件,然后用vim打开.bashrc这个目录,在最后添加“source $HOME/z.sh”。
然后回到shell执行:source .bashrc。这样这个东西就生效了。
怎么用呢?你就像平常一样切换目录就行了,z会记录下你的最终目录。
比如说你切换到/home/the5fire/learn/python,然后执行一下:z[回车],就会输出一个目录,这时它就会帮你记住这个目录,以后如果想要进这个目录的话,无论是在哪个目录下执行执行:z python[回车]即可。在没有重复的情况下执行:z p[回车]也是有效的。
有了z武器,你还用敲大量的cd命令来切换目录吗?
z foo cd to most frecent dir matching foo z foo bar cd to most frecent dir matching foo and bar z -r foo cd to highest ranked dir matching foo z -t foo cd to most recently accessed dir matching foo z -l foo list all dirs matching foo (by frecency)
相关推荐
CV战士的自我修养2—移动与跳转(csdn)————程序
基本模型机的设计——跳转指令的实现基本模型机的设计——跳转指令的实现基本模型机的设计——跳转指令的实现基本模型机的设计——跳转指令的实现基本模型机的设计——跳转指令的实现基本模型机的设计——跳转指令的...
typora目录跳转
Jmp——>EB 跳转指令 Jnz——>75 跳转指令 Je——>74 跳转指令 Nop——>90 无用指令 方法三:00填充法 方法四:输入表函数移位法 另外C32可以改sys的驱动文件 [特征] 0009B89A_00000002 [特征] 0005FDFA_...
中国银联全渠道支付平台-产品接口规范-商户卷-第1部分 互联网支付跳转产品——网关支付产品
应用函数指针数组、二维数组——跳转表。 跳转表实现袖珍型计算器。 可以和Jump_table.cpp对比一下。建议使用Jump_table.cpp。
Activity跳转 四种跳转方式
懒人有福了Internet快捷方式生成器网页跳转生成工具,可以 自定义生成快捷方式,对于网页保存文件非常好的支持,绿色不用安装
安卓Android源码——(Activity跳转与操作).zip
相对于传统的rewrite方式,这种由refresh跳转的方式更为彻底,也更安全,快捷!!百度知乎等网站都在使用这种跳转方式,值得一试
4.6 目录列表——dir 75 4.7 使用嵌套列表 76 4.7.1 定义列表的嵌套 77 4.7.2 无序列表和有序列表的嵌套 78 4.8 小结 79 4.9 习题 80 第5章 超链接 81 教学录像:22分钟 5.1 超链接的基本知识 ...
jsp页面的五种跳转方式 java jsp
Servlet跳转方式 sendReDirectServlet跳转方式 sendReDirectServlet跳转方式 sendReDirectServlet跳转方式 sendReDirectServlet跳转方式 sendReDirect
给一些不会做文档目录(跳转至目录页)的朋友下载。。。
安卓Android源码——(Activity跳转与操作).rar
界面跳转界面跳转界面跳转界面跳转界面跳转界面跳转界面跳转界面跳转界面跳转界面跳转界面跳转界面跳转界面跳转
IOS应用源码——跳转到app store的小案例.zip
IOS应用源码——跳转到app store的小案例.rar